What brand of TV? Flat screen? Does the TV have a feature known as "backlighting"? Experience has shown that large flat screen TVs with backlighting can cause some pretty severe IR interference with the #1 IR remote. As others have said, if you have a remote that is IR/UHF, you can change the switch back where the batteries are to UHF, press "System Info" on the receiver, then press SAT then RECORD, and it will re-address remote #1, and will make it UHF. That will often cure issues with remote #1 and IR interference.
